Description
Lewis Carroll?s masterpiece, Through the Looking Glass, is brought to life in the stunning artwork of Maggie Taylor. Her prints incorporate photographic elements, scanned illustrations, sculptures, and artifacts pinned against timeless backgrounds. Her images?at once beautiful and menacing, real and surreal?create a visual counterpoint to Carroll?s writing style. She casts numerous individuals into the ever-changing roles and circumstances of the bewildered Alice, creating a complex, multi-faceted every-woman still easy to identify in each scene. This modern digital approach to a classic tale is a collaboration Carroll himself would have truly enjoyed.
